Exploring Potential Careers and Skills Development

Choosing a career path is a significant decision that can shape your future. It is essential to explore various options and consider how you can develop the necessary skills for your chosen field. Here, we discuss different careers and methods for skill development to help you make informed choices.

1. Technology

Technology is a rapidly growing field with numerous career opportunities. Roles in software development, cybersecurity, data analysis, and IT support are in high demand. To excel in the tech industry, consider learning programming languages like Python, Java, or C++, and gaining certifications relevant to your desired role.

2. Healthcare

The healthcare sector offers diverse career paths such as nursing, medical assisting, physical therapy, and healthcare administration. Developing skills like empathy, critical thinking, and attention to detail is crucial for success in healthcare. Pursuing relevant certifications and degrees can also enhance your prospects.

3. Marketing

Marketing professionals play a vital role in promoting products and services. Skills such as market research, social media management, content creation, and analytical abilities are highly valued in this field. Consider gaining experience through internships and online courses to build your marketing skills.

4. Finance

Finance offers careers in areas like accounting, financial analysis, investment banking, and financial planning. Str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a good understanding of financial markets are essential for success in finance. Pursuing a finance-related degree and obtaining professional certifications can boost your credibility.

5. Creative Arts

For those passionate about creativity, careers in the arts, design, and media can be fulfilling. Developing skills in graphic design, photography, video production, or performing arts can open up opportunities in this competitive industry. Building a strong portfolio and networking with professionals can help you establish yourself in the creative field.
